About Steareth-60 Cetyl Ether
Steareth-60 Cetyl Ether is an organic compound.[1] The number 60 at the end of the name refers to the average number of ethylene oxide units added. It changes the balance between water-loving and oil-loving parts, creating differences in cleansing ability, emulsifying ability, and sensory feel. In cosmetics, it is used to adjust the viscosity and flow of formulations.[2]
